- Notes
- WIT and Lapidus copy lack imprint on title page: London: Printed by H.S. Woodfall, for T. Cadell, in the Strand; and sold by J. Wilkie, in St. Paul’s Church-yard. (ESTC T48800)
- In WIT and Lapidus copies: Errata on verso of title page for pages 65 and 69. On the issue with full imprint, the errata are for pages 18 and 22. (ESTC T48800)
- On the question of commercial relations between the British West Indies and the thirteen colonies. The two witnesses examined were George Walker and John Ellis.
- WIT copy is no. 8 of a volume of pamphlets.
